The majority of radars on the market at present offer only a single mode of operation or apply the mode for one application directly to another application despite mismatches in target type and radar environments. However, radars are now becoming available that offer the operation of all three modes simultaneously and these multi-mode radars enable optimal performance in each of the three domains in which they operate: air, ground and water. The multi-mode radar needs to be able to handle simultaneously the complex operational needs of each unique environment.
Multi-mode radars offer traditional radar capabilities while at the same time allowing extended capabilities including drone, covert boat and crawler detection. The radar can apply its different modes depending on where it is looking. Radar beams pointing upwards will use air modes. This allows optimised drone detection, without significant ground clutter management. Radar beams pointing horizontally or even downwards will use ground or coastal modes. This allows surface clutter to be optimally filtered while still being able to detect drones. The switch between ground and coastal modes can be made automatically based on geographics inputs from a regional coastline map.
